Primary Elections
This Tuesday, there will be a number of contested primaries that Democrats and Republicans will be able to vote in. If you are Unenrolled, you may re-register and enroll in a party on Tuesday and vote for your favored candidates. Here is a list of candidates and the races they are in. If a race is not listed, that means those candidates are not in a competitive primary.
